About Hannan, Japan
Tucked away in Osaka Prefecture, Hannan offers a refreshing escape from the bustling city life. It's a charming blend of traditional Japanese culture and modern convenience, perfect for those seeking an authentic Japanese experience without the overwhelming crowds of major cities. Best Time to Visit Hannan, Japan
Spring and autumn offer pleasant weather, ideal for exploring outdoors. Summer can be hot and humid, while winter can be quite cold. Check the weather forecast closer to your travel dates.
